This quilt is similar to the "I Spy with my Eye" quilt that I made for Madeline this year. This one was made for Cousin Tricia's son CJ (Cameron John). See the first "I Spy" quilt for details about the pattern. The jars were made slightly longer to better accommodate some of the larger prints and I added one more column since CJ is no longer a baby. He will be 2 this year. CJ and I share a birthday, October 6. CJ comes from a "mixed" union; his mother is a Packer fan and his dad is a Viking fan. So, I added a "jar" for each them. CJ spends time on his grandpa's farm, so I added some cow, barn, and tractor prints. Also his grandma went to Hawaii this year, and brought him back an Aloha shirt, so I added a "jar" with a scrap left from the Aloha shirt Mother made Keith. The signature rabbit was quilted in a "jar" containing carrots. CJ seems to like his quilt. There have been several pictures of him playing on it posted in Facebook. Size: 50" x 62" Child or Play Blanket size
Quilting: Quilted in a meandering loose stipple with loose spirals. Used brown polyester thread (Omni from Superior Threads-named "Milk Chocolate"). Free form quilting. 7 bobbins. Quilting by Patty.
Backing: Chocolate brown and yellow print from a JoAnn's sale. 
Batting: 50-50 cotton and polyester.
Binding:  Dark chocolate fabric from my stash. 
Pattern: Jars from a Missouri Star Quilting Company video.
